BTS’s J-Hope Feels The Love From ARMYs As He Visits Fan Projects On His Birthday

According to his recent Instagram update, the first stop on BTS J-Hope‘s birthday tour is back home!

Specifically, he checked out “K-Pop Star Street” in Chungjang-ro, Gwangju. The sculpture, named “Hope World” after J-Hope’s first mixtape, contains 21,800 messages of support and love for J-Hope from ARMYs all around the world.
